OK, since I did not get any responses from my post on cameras. I have looked on Nav tool for the interfaces and on ebay. Costs run from 260-450. Camera costs can vary from $35 to $200. Some camera even have 360 views. Anyone have suggestions on which is the best for our car for plug and play.? Or am I just hoping for p&p. It does not look hard but looks like you have to remove the front screen to have access. Is Nav Tool the best place to go?

I have 2 NavTool setups and have found them... a workable solution but not as easy as 'plug and play' to install. The one in my LR3 works 90% of the time (the 10% of the time it cycles to blue screen and comes back after powering the car off). The one on my Super V8 works perfectly every time. Technical support is not great, but they eventually answered my questions.

I would describe them as 'cut wire, strip wire, solder in new connections and play' but I do like how it's a very OEM-feel once the install is done. I ran the camera from the trunk lid, all the wiring for the NavTool is done on the left side of the trunk and there is no need to pull the front center console and Nav screens. Those are pluses.
